Leveraging Data for Tactical Insights
Sports analytics offers a powerful lens through which to dissect team performance, moving beyond subjective observation to quantifiable metrics. By analyzing vast datasets encompassing player statistics, passing networks, defensive formations, and even biomechanical data, coaches and analysts can identify patterns and trends that might otherwise remain hidden. This granular understanding allows for the development of more precise tactical strategies, tailored to exploit opponent weaknesses and maximize a team’s own strengths. For instance, identifying a specific opponent’s vulnerability to counter-attacks in transition could lead to a game plan focused on quick turnovers and direct attacking play.
The application of predictive analytics in football extends to player development and injury prevention. By monitoring training load, player fatigue levels, and physiological responses, sports scientists can proactively manage athlete well-being, reducing the risk of injuries and optimizing performance peaks. Furthermore, the detailed analysis of individual player movements and decision-making can inform targeted training regimes, helping players refine specific skills and tactical awareness. This data-informed approach ensures that team practices are not just about physical exertion, but also about intelligent, evidence-based development.
The Role of Algorithms in Performance Forecasting
Algorithms are at the forefront of modern sports analytics, capable of processing complex variables to predict outcomes with increasing accuracy. These computational models can factor in a multitude of elements, from historical performance data and player form to contextual factors like home advantage, weather conditions, and even the psychological impact of recent results. While no algorithm can perfectly predict the inherently unpredictable nature of a football match, they provide valuable probabilistic insights that can inform decision-making at all levels.
The integration of these predictive models is particularly evident in areas like match-day strategy and player recruitment. By understanding the statistical likelihood of certain events occurring, managers can make more informed substitutions, adjust formations mid-game, or even influence in-game management decisions. In recruitment, algorithms can sift through a global pool of talent, identifying players who statistically align with a team’s needs and playing style, thereby streamlining the scouting process and potentially uncovering undervalued assets before rivals do.
Navigating the Uncertainty: Upsets and the Human Element
Despite the advancements in sports analytics and predictive modeling, the enduring appeal of football lies in its inherent unpredictability. Upsets, where the statistically less favored team triumphs, remain a crucial element that keeps fans engaged and generates moments of sporting drama. These unexpected results serve as a vital reminder that human factors—grit, determination, moments of individual genius, or even sheer luck—can defy statistical probabilities. Therefore, while data provides invaluable insights, it must be balanced with an understanding of the intangible elements that shape the sport.
The challenge for teams and analysts is to harness the power of data to improve preparation and understanding without becoming overly reliant on predictions that may not always hold true. A data-driven approach should augment, not replace, the human element of the game. This means using analytical insights to refine tactics and training, but also recognizing the need for adaptability, psychological resilience, and the capacity to respond to unforeseen circumstances. The most successful teams will be those that effectively blend analytical rigor with the intuition and passion that define football.
